Abstract

This paper for the purpose of utilization, conducted a study of technological process of producing animal feed by fer- menting seaweed waste. Anaerobic fermentation, which can improve the contents of protein and polysaccharide in sea- weed waste, proved to be an available method to improve the nutritional value of animal feed by using seaweed waste. Also effects of different additives and fermentation time on the fermentation products was compared, combined CCRD with neural network to optimize these factors, the predict model among all factors was established, also obtained the optimal fermentation process.
